About the role
Join our team as our Billing & AR Quality Control Manager. We're looking for someone who thrives on accuracy, process improvement, and leading high-performing teams.
Responsibilities
- Lead and develop a team of billing & AR professionals with coaching and performance feedback.
- Ensure accurate, timely billing across claims, fees, and client charges.
- Design and maintain strong billing controls to prevent errors and duplicate charges.
- Monitor AR balances, unapplied cash, and payment trends to improve collection efficiency.
- Build dashboards and metrics to track accuracy, timeliness, and quality outcomes.
- Partner across Finance, IT, and Client Experience teams to streamline processes and implement new tools.
- Act as a subject matter expert during audits, client reviews, and system upgrades.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field.
- 5+ years’ experience in billing, AR, or revenue cycle management (healthcare/PBM preferred).
- Proven leadership with direct staff supervision experience.
- Strong knowledge of internal controls, reconciliations, and revenue recognition.
- Experience with ERP/accounting systems and billing automation tools.
- Excellent problem-solving, communication, and analytical skills.
